1. A method comprising:
receiving a request from a user device for registration with a serving private 5G network, wherein the serving private 5G network is part of a private 5G federation system and the request from the user device received upon broadcasting of a message by an access point of the serving private 5G network indicating that the serving private 5G network is part of the private 5G federation system;
determining that the user device is authenticated with a home private 5G network of the user device, wherein the home private 5G network is part of the private 5G federation system;
in response to determining that the user device is authenticated with the home private 5G network, transmitting, to the serving private 5G network, a security profile of the user device that is received from the home private 5G network; and
facilitating onboarding of the user device to the serving private 5G network with the security profile.
